I use large maps in my campaigns. FG2 is much more stable with large maps, so it works out well (as long as I remember to preshare the maps!). Anyway, I've discovered a problem when using a large map.
When hovering over a tracked token, FG is supposed to shade in the squares that the creature can reach. And when using an area-effect pointer (cone, circle, square), it's supposed to shade the affected squares. Well, when using a large map, zoomed out and expanded as far as FG will let you, if the shaded squares are far enough down or far enough to the right, FG won't actually shade them. You can see this especially well if you move an AE pointer down from the top of the map toward the bottom - eventually, the shaded squares just get cut off once they reach a line some portion of the way down.
Just wanted to file this as a bug report :) This also occurred in FG1.
